FEM analysis is becoming an important tool in the metal forming industry. Many structure analysis codes are applied to simulate metal forming processes. In these codes, the treatment of contact between tools and the work-piece is an important problem. The authors have developed a penalty method contact algorithm which can treat the contact problem and the friction problem at the same time. This algorithm is incorporated into a 3-dimensional rigid-plastic FEM code. In this code, the tool surface is expressed by a B-spline patch, which can describe smooth surfaces by few control vertices. Using this 3-dimensional code, a square cup deep drawing process is analyzed. In this analysis, 8-node isoparametric solid elements are used. Reasonable results are obtained.
